#50784a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50784a is composed of 31.4% red, 47.1%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 112.2 degrees, a saturation of 23.7% and a lightness of 38%. #50784a color hex could be obtained by blending #a0f094 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#50784a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b07 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#50784a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616260 is the less saturated color, while #1ebb07 is the most saturated one.
